The Married Woman on ALTBalaji: An unconventional love story

ALTBalaji boss Ekta Kapoor has revealed the first official teaser for the platform’s upcoming web series, ‘The Married Woman.’ It stars Ridhi Dogra and Monica Dogra in the lead. The series will premiere on International Women’s Day i.e. March 8.

The show is an official adaptation of Manju Kapur’s book, ‘A Married Woman’, which was published in 2002.

It narrates the story of a Delhi middle-class married woman, Astha, who begins an extra marital affair with a younger woman. This happens amidst the 1992 political and religious unrest in the country which was caused due to the Babri Masjid demolition in Ayodhya, and the lingering taboo against homosexuality.

The series was announced in January 2020 but was delayed due to the Covid-19 pandemic.

ALTBalaji tweeted the news over a year ago while informing that shooting was yet to begin.

Both leads, Monica Dogra and Ridhi Dogra, will make their digital debuts with this show.

According to the official description the series is “an unconventional love story of two beautiful souls who rose beyond religious, sexual and societal boundaries to find each other”.

Furthermore, it explains that ‘The Married Woman’ highlights “individuality beyond conditioning, spirituality beyond religion and connections beyond sexuality.”
